The kessil and typhon are both pwn right? Just different connectors....
Typhon is PWM, Kessil is 0-10V IIRC, that may have changed with latest version but that was one thing that soured me commercial controllers some years back is they were 0-10V output and the explanation I got from the service reps was "because that's what most of the COMMERCIAL lighting systems use", now the Apex might be able to do both now for all I know. But the Typhon "out of the box" is PWM, but it is/was aimed at DIYers where the super cheap and tiny Meanwell HDD drivers are PWM adjustable.
